ZIP 05828 is a ZIP code of 2,092 people in Caledonia County. At a median age of 54.1, this is an older place than the country as a whole. Owners hold 85% of the housing stock. 2% of people in this ZIP code were born outside the United States. Density works out to 38 people per square mile. The poverty rate is 5.9%, under the national 12.5%. Among the 15 ZIP codes in Caledonia County, 05828 ranks 8th by median household income.
